Transaction 1c8c141e8c70b95a787bf43898c8c29cbea89bd5258f5659d9e4d1c6c4ec1f33

57 Input
2 Outputs
  • 1c8c141e8c70b95a787bf43898c8c29cbea89bd5258f5659d9e4d1c6c4ec1f33:0
  • value  5948807837
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 1c8c141e8c70b95a787bf43898c8c29cbea89bd5258f5659d9e4d1c6c4ec1f33:1
  • value  1127625
    address  3AbBHfkaxZZrRYh73FLzcFchrgThddQEGe